What is the difference between Av Programming vs AV Installation Technician?

AspectAv ProgrammingAV Installation Technician
CredentialsTypically requires programming certifications, AV software knowledgeFocuses on hardware setup, basic electrical skills
Work EnvironmentOffice or control room, programming labsOn-site at client locations, physical installation sites
Industry UsageDesigning and customizing AV systems through programmingInstalling and configuring AV equipment
Common Search/ComparisonAv Programming vs AV Installation Technician

Av Programming involves creating custom control systems and software for AV setups, requiring programming skills and software knowledge. In contrast, AV Installation Technicians focus on physically installing and configuring AV hardware on-site. Both roles are essential in the AV industry but differ in skills, environment, and responsibilities.

AV Programmer 
Location: Reston, VA 
Required Clearance: Top Secret/SCI with CI Poly  Since 1999, ITEC has delivered mission-critical support to the DoD and Intelligence Community. Now part of ManpowerGroup Public Sector (MGPS), we continue that work with expanded capabilities. Employees hired through this process will join MGPS and receive a comprehensive benefits package and competitive pay.   U.S. Citizenship Mandatory: Due to our US federal government contract, candidates for this position are required to be a US Citizen and will be subject to a background investigation.   Job Responsibilities: * Design, develop, and test high performance, AV solutions for government customers. * Generate custom audiovisual system designs using Crestron technologies. * Support customer stakeholder meetings to collect and document or validate system requirements. * Research, identify, and recommend technology options, to solve customer issues. * Support onsite deployment of AV systems and system configuration phases. * Coordinate with customer facilities teams and other onsite sub-contractors and vendors during systems installation as required. * Support the development of end-user training materials and operations and maintenance plans. * Perform in-house testing and on-site commissioning at client locations. * Develop expertise in the industry through continuing training, certifications, and continued review of trade publications.  
Required Skills: * Level 2: 1+ years of related work experience or an equivalent combination of education and experience. * Proficiency in modern programming and scripting languages such as C#, C++, Java, JavaScript, Perl, Python, and Visual Basic. * Experience in system integration, testing, and troubleshooting of complex A/V systems. * Hands-on experience with network programming. *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to detail. * Familiarity with systems engineering principles and integration best practices. 
Desired Skills: * Level 3: 3+ years of related systems design and integration experience, or equivalent education and experience. * Level 4: 5+ years of related systems design and integration experience, or equivalent education and experience. * Experience with Crestron programming and system environments using SIMPL+ or C#. * Experience translating customer requirements into software designs. * Knowledge of software systems configuration management. * Experience with object orientated programming. * Experience with HTML/web programming (for user interface design). * Crestron Gold level programming Certification or higher. * Experience working with local and remote teams. * Experience interfacing directly with all levels of staff and management. * Experience working as a member of a development team.
